History & UNESCO Significance
The Biblical Tels are revered for their immense cultural and archaeological significance. Recognized by UNESCO, these sites reveal layers of history that date back to thousands of years, showcasing the evolution of human civilization in this pivotal region. Megiddo is famously mentioned in biblical prophecies and is known as the site of Armageddon. Hazor, once the largest Canaanite city, boasts impressive ruins and is pivotal in the study of ancient Near Eastern culture. Meanwhile, Beer Sheba highlights the deep biblical narrative tied to Abraham and the patriarchs. Each site is an extraordinary testament to the interconnectedness of heritage and faith throughout history.

Top Things to Do at the Biblical Tels
The Biblical Tels offer an array of fascinating attractions:
- Explore the ancient ruins of Megiddo, including the impressive water system and the remains of its fortified city.
- Wander through the archaeological remains of Hazor, home to ancient temples and gates. Don’t miss the bre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ape.
